From 84732a8849a08d42a9a95dcbee9005116be78eb8 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Khem Raj <raj.khem@gmail.com>
Date: Sun, 7 Aug 2022 14:39:19 -0700
Subject: [PATCH] check for sys/pidfd.h
This header in newer glibc defines the signatures of functions
pidfd_send_signal() and pidfd_open() and when these functions are
defined by libc then we need to include the relevant header to get
the definitions. Clang 15+ has started to error out when function
signatures are missing.
Fixes errors like
misc-utils/kill.c:402:6: error: call to undeclared function 'pidfd_send_signal'; ISO C99 and later do not support implicit function declarations [-Wimplicit-function-declaration]
if (pidfd_send_signal(pfd, ctl->numsig, &info, 0) < 0)
Signed-off-by: Khem Raj <raj.khem@gmail.com>
---
configure.ac | 1 +
include/pidfd-utils.h | 4 +++-
2 files changed, 4 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/configure.ac b/configure.ac
index 51deeecd4e..daa8f0dca4 100644
--- a/configure.ac
+++ b/configure.ac
@@ -342,6 +342,7 @@ AC_CHECK_HEADERS([ \
sys/mkdev.h \
sys/mount.h \
sys/param.h \
+ sys/pidfd.h \
sys/prctl.h \
sys/resource.h \
sys/sendfile.h \
diff --git a/include/pidfd-utils.h b/include/pidfd-utils.h
index eddede9767..d9e33cbc57 100644
--- a/include/pidfd-utils.h
+++ b/include/pidfd-utils.h
@@ -4,8 +4,10 @@
#ifdef HAVE_SYS_SYSCALL_H
# include <sys/syscall.h>
# if defined(SYS_pidfd_send_signal) && defined(SYS_pidfd_open)
+# ifdef HAVE_SYS_PIDFD_H
+# include <sys/pidfd.h>
+# endif
# include <sys/types.h>
-
# ifndef HAVE_PIDFD_SEND_SIGNAL
static inline int pidfd_send_signal(int pidfd, int sig, siginfo_t *info,
unsigned int flags)

From 28b391ce7e58f8327c092b3911c05f526d0ad586 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Karel Zak <kzak@redhat.com>
Date: Wed, 15 Jun 2022 10:03:44 +0200
Subject: [PATCH] more: restore exit-on-eof if POSIXLY_CORRECT is not set
In version 2.38, exit-on-eof has been disabled by default. This change
is annoying for users and forces many users to use 'alias more="more
-e"'. It seems better to force POSIX lovers to use POSIXLY_CORRECT
env. variable and stay backwardly compatible by default.
Addresses: https://github.com/util-linux/util-linux/issues/1703
Addresses: https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=2088493
Signed-off-by: Karel Zak <kzak@redhat.com>
--- a/text-utils/more.c
+++ b/text-utils/more.c
@@ -2052,8 +2052,11 @@ int main(int argc, char **argv)
if (!(strcmp(program_invocation_short_name, "page")))
ctl.no_scroll++;
+ ctl.exit_on_eof = getenv("POSIXLY_CORRECT") ? 0 : 1;
+
if ((s = getenv("MORE")) != NULL)
env_argscan(&ctl, s);
+
argscan(&ctl, argc, argv);
/* clear any inherited settings */

From 404b0781f52f7c045ca811b2dceec526408ac253 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Karel Zak <kzak@redhat.com>
Date: Thu, 21 Mar 2024 11:16:20 +0100
Subject: [PATCH] wall: fix escape sequence Injection [CVE-2024-28085]
Let's use for all cases the same output function.
Reported-by: Skyler Ferrante <sjf5462@rit.edu>
Signed-off-by: Karel Zak <kzak@redhat.com>
--- a/term-utils/wall.c
+++ b/term-utils/wall.c
@@ -368,7 +368,7 @@ static char *makemsg(char *fname, char **mvec, int mvecsz,
int i;
for (i = 0; i < mvecsz; i++) {
- fputs(mvec[i], fs);
+ fputs_careful(mvec[i], fs, '^', true, TERM_WIDTH);
if (i < mvecsz - 1)
fputc(' ', fs);
}

From 4b2e6f5071a4c5beebbd9668d24dc05defc096d7 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Tanish Yadav <devtany@gmail.com>
Date: Tue, 5 Mar 2024 00:51:41 +0530
Subject: [PATCH] su: fix use after free in run_shell
Do not free tmp for non login branch as basename may return a pointer to
some part of it.
[kzak@redhat.com: - improve coding style of the function]
Signed-off-by: Tanish Yadav <devtany@gmail.com>
Signed-off-by: Karel Zak <kzak@redhat.com>
---
login-utils/su-common.c | 9 ++++-----
1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)
diff --git a/login-utils/su-common.c b/login-utils/su-common.c
index 242b6ce4ea..9bc0231961 100644
--- a/login-utils/su-common.c
+++ b/login-utils/su-common.c
@@ -835,13 +835,14 @@ static void run_shell(
size_t n_args = 1 + su->fast_startup + 2 * ! !command + n_additional_args + 1;
const char **args = xcalloc(n_args, sizeof *args);
size_t argno = 1;
+ char *tmp;
DBG(MISC, ul_debug("starting shell [shell=%s, command=\"%s\"%s%s]",
shell, command,
su->simulate_login ? " login" : "",
su->fast_startup ? " fast-start" : ""));
+ tmp = xstrdup(shell);
- char* tmp = xstrdup(shell);
if (su->simulate_login) {
char *arg0;
char *shell_basename;
@@ -851,10 +852,8 @@ static void run_shell(
arg0[0] = '-';
strcpy(arg0 + 1, shell_basename);
args[0] = arg0;
- } else {
- args[0] = basename(tmp);
- }
- free(tmp);
+ } else
+ args[0] = basename(tmp);
if (su->fast_startup)
args[argno++] = "-f";
